#1 - those are not stage 1. They are OEM replacement.

#2 - Theyr are 100% full replicas of exedy on ebay as well. same logo, box, everything .. except its garbage. Also clutch pressure plates can explode if not designed properly. Most clutch instructions warn of possible injury or fatality if the clutch pressure plate blows (think connecting rod shooting out the block and threw your head).

I got that clutch kit and it works great with my XTD 11lb flywheel. The only thing that really sucks is the throwout bearing was no good and now my car makes noise when the clutch is not engaged. So i would get OEM Honda TB if I did it again becasue it is pretty cheap.
